Is there an American Psycho musical?

Is there an American Psycho musical?

American Psycho is a musical with music and lyrics by Duncan Sheik and a book by Roberto Aguirre-Sacasa. It is based on the controversial 1991 novel American Psycho by Bret Easton Ellis, which also inspired a 2000 film of the same name, which starred Christian Bale.

Is American Psycho A jukebox musical?

American Psycho is set in the 1980s, but is not a standard retro jukebox musical. There are a couple of 80s pop tunes that sneak in as numbers (though these are are hauntingly rescored) and the Casey Kasem “American Top 40” broadcast that plays before the show is an absolute chef’s-kiss touch.

Is American Psycho a classic book?

With an introduction by Irvine Welsh, Bret Easton Ellis’s American Psychois one of the most controversial and talked-about novels of all time. A multi-million-copy bestseller hailed as a modern classic, it is a violent black comedy about the darkest side of human nature.
